文化經濟學-文化創意產業3
作者:DAVID THROSBY  出版社:典藏  出版日:2003/10/01 裝訂:平裝
經濟學與文化──就像南半球和北半球,它們是人類社會裡最關心的兩件事,但長久以來卻像井水不犯河水般存在於人類社會。 本書對文化採取較寬廣的定義,從學術領域到社會組織的系統,探索文化的經濟面,以及經濟學的文化脈絡。 全書以價值理論為基礎,從經濟價值的及文化價值兩種概念出發,將兩造之間整合起來。 書中討論文化資本與文化的永續性,尤其在分析文化遺產問題時,採取生態經濟學處理自然資本的方式。

Economics and Culture
90折
作者:David Throsby  出版社:Cambridge Univ Pr  出版日:2000/12/21 裝訂:平裝
In an increasingly globalised world, economic and cultural imperatives can be seen as two of the most powerful forces shaping human behaviour. This book considers the relationship between economics and culture both as areas of intellectual discourse, and as systems of societal organisation. Adopting a broad definition of culture, it explores the economic dimensions of culture, and the cultural context of economics. The book is built on a foundation of value theory, developing the twin notions of economic and cultural value as underlying principles for integrating the two fields. Ideas of cultural capital and sustainability are discussed, especially as means of analysing the particular problems of cultural heritage, drawing parallels with the treatment of natural capital in ecological economics. The book goes on to discuss the economics of creativity in the production of cultural goods and services; culture in economic development; the cultural industries; and cultural policy.

The Economics of Cultural Policy
作者:David Throsby  出版社:Cambridge Univ Pr  出版日:2010/07/05 裝訂:精裝
Cultural policy is changing. Traditionally, cultural policies have been concerned with providing financial support for the arts, for cultural heritage and for institutions such as museums and galleries. In recent years, around the world, interest has grown in the creative industries as a source of innovation and economic dynamism. This book argues that an understanding of the nature of both the economic and the cultural value created by the cultural sector is essential to good policy-making. The book is the first comprehensive account of the application of economic theory and analysis to the broad field of cultural policy. It deals with general principles of policy-making in the cultural arena as seen from an economic point of view, and goes on to examine a range of specific cultural policy areas, including the arts, heritage, the cultural industries, urban development, tourism, education, trade, cultural diversity, economic development, intellectual property and cultural statistics.
